#1280c1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1280c1 is composed of 7.1% red, 50.2%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.7% cyan, 33.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 202.3 degrees, a saturation of 82.9% and a lightness of 41.4%. #1280c1 color hex could be obtained by blending #24ffff with #000183. Closest websafe color is: #0099cc.

#1280c1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1280c1 has RGB values of R:18, G:128, B:193 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.34,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 1212609.

Shades and Tints of #1280c1
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01090e is the darkest color, while #fbfdff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1280c1
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#636b70 is the less saturated color, while #0284d1 is the most saturated one.
